General Remarks

  • The presenting author of the abstract selected for presentation must be registered at the Congress.
  • Abstracts cannot be solely descriptive but must contain data.
  • Data reported in abstracts must derive from experiments that meet international ethical standards.
  • Abbreviations should be defined.
  • Abstracts should clearly indicate the scientific question addressed in the study and its importance, a brief description of methods, objective data to answer the scientific question and conclusions of the study directly supported by the results.
  • Trade names cannot be mentioned in titles. However, trade names in brackets will be accepted in the body of the text.
  • Please insure your abstract does not contain spelling, grammar or scientific mistakes, as it will be reproduced exactly as submitted. Linguistic accuracy is your responsibility.
  • The reviewers will judge the abstracts according to the relevance to SIOP ASIA, objectivity of statements, description of what was done, suitability of methods to aims, conclusions confirmed by objective results, ethics, scientific value, potential clinical value and originality of work.

Presentation of Abstracts

  • Abstracts will be accepted either as a poster or an oral communication.
  • Presenting authors for posters will be requested to attend their poster and be available for discussion from 12:30 PM to 2:15 PM on the day of your poster session.
  • The usable poster board surface is· 83 inches (211 cm) wide and 46 inches (117 cm) high (landscape format).
  • Please use letters large enough to be read from a distance of about 5 feet (1.5 meters).
  • Oral presentations will be allocated 10 minutes for presentation plus 5 minutes for discussion. Equipment for projection of PowerPoint presentations onto a single screen will be available in all session rooms.
